This project intends to apply XH06 PET/CT or PET/MR imaging to patients suspected or diagnosed with hepatocellular carcinoma (liver mass), and compare it with enhanced magnetic resonance imaging. Using surgical/biopsy pathology as the gold standard, the diagnostic efficacy of XH06 PET/CT or PET/MR imaging for primary and metastatic lesions of hepatocellular carcinoma will be evaluated. The purpose is to further confirm the advantages of XH06 PET/CT or PET/MR in the diagnosis and staging of hepatocellular carcinoma through prospective, multicenter clinical studies, to compensate for the shortcomings of conventional imaging techniques in the diagnosis and staging of hepatocellular carcinoma, and to provide more accurate information to guide clinical treatment decisions for hepatocellular carcinoma.

At least two experienced nuclear medicine physicians will conduct a visual analysis using consensus reading. The standardized uptake value (SUV) of tumor and organs will be measured after a semiquantitative analysis is conducted for each case. The SUV ranges from 0 to infinity, and a higher score means a higher uptake of targeting GPC3 nuclear probe by the tumor, which implies a greater threat of the tumor being malignant or higher stage.
